ELECTRICAL ADJUSTMENT
No.
Adjustment Items
Adjustment Conditions
Adjustment Procedures
1
Initialization of
EEPROM
1. Turn on the power (the lamp lights
up) and warm up the system for 15
minutes.
1. Make the following settings.
Press S2601 to enter the process mode, and
execute S2 on the SSS menu. Now the
EEPROM, except for the PC I/F unit, is
initialised.
Do not execute S1, or the PC I/F unit itself
will be initialised.
(The PC I/F unit has been factory adjusted.)
To adjust the PC I/F unit, refer to the end of
the section.
2
Adjustment of
RGB1 black level
signal amplitude
1. Select the following group and
subjects.
Group: OUTPUT1
Subject: G1-BLK, G1-GAIN
For the colour R, select the subjects
R1-BLK and R1-GAIN.
For the colour B, select the subjects
B1-BLK and B1-GAIN.
2. Make sure the process adjustment
colour bars are displayed.
3. For the colour G, connect a
oscilloscope to pin (2) of P1301.
4. For the colours R and B, connect
the oscilloscope to pin (1) of P1301
and pin (3) of P1301, respectively.
1. Select the subject G1-GAIN. Using the
set's control switch or the remote controller
button, adjust the setting so that the signal
amplitude is 4.2 Vp-p±0.05 V.
2. Select the subject G1-BLK. Using the set's
control switch or the remote controller
button, adjust the setting so that the white-
to-white level is 1.4 Vp-p±0.1 V.
3. Do the same for the other colours R and
B.
3
Adjustment of
PSIG
1. Select the following group and
subjects.
Group: OUTPUT2
Subject: PSIG-H, PSIG-L
Make sure the PSIG-H and PSIGL
settings are 145 and 195,
respectively.
1. Get the PSIG waveform displayed.
(Feed the XGA signal.)

No.
Adjustment Items
Adjustment Conditions
Adjustment Procedures
4
Checking of
sample-and-hold
pulse phase
1. Feed the XGA-mode 75-Hz black
signal.
2. Select the following group and
subject.
Group: OUTPUT3
Subject: GCK-PHASE
1. Check the blurring of the letters of
OUTPUT 3 and the ghost.
2. Raise the value of the ENBXR-PH until
the front ghost appears on the left side of the
letters of OSD.
3. When the value is lowered for 1 – 2
points, the front ghost disappears. Set it to
the value for 1 lowered from the value when
the front ghost disappears.(In case that the
front ghost appears when the value of the
EMBXR-PH is 11 and disappears when it is
10, set it to 9.)
4. Adjust the green and blue in the same
manner.
5
Adjustment of
RGB counter-voltage
1. Feed the counter-voltage
adjustment signal (XGA) prepared by
the Technical Department.
2. Select the following group and
subjects.
Group: OUTPUT3
Subject: RC (R), GC (G), BC (B)
1. Using the set's control switch or the
remote controller button, adjust the settings
to minimise flickers.
2. If the results are inconsistent at the centre
and on both sides onscreen, readjust the
settings to get the same results on both
sides.
6
Adjustment of
RGB gradation
reproduction
1. Feed the SMPTE pattern signal.
2. Select the following group and
subject.
Group: OUTPUT1
Subject: G1-BLK
1. Confirm that the 100% and 95% white
gradation as well as the 0% and 5% black
gradation are discernible.
2. If the white gradation looks differently,
finely adjust the G1-BLK setting.
7
Adjustment of
RGB white balance
1. Feed the 32-step grey scale signal
(XGA, 60 Hz).
2. Select the following group and
subjects.
Group: OUTPUT1
Subjects: R1-BLK (R), B1-BLK (B)
1. Adjust the R1-BLK and B1-BLK settings
to have the specified gradation balance
(according to the standard monitor).
8
Adjustment of
video AGC
1. Feed the NTSC 10-step grey scale
signal.
2. Select the following group and
subject.
Group: VIDEO
Subject: AGC-ADJ
3. Connect the oscilloscope between
TP4501 and TP4502
1. Using the set's control switch or the
remote controller button, adjust the setting
so that the white-to-black level is 0.72 Vp-
p±0.01 V.
9
Adjustment of
video brightness/
contrast
1. Feed the NTSC 100% window
pattern signal.
2. Select the following group and
subjects.
Group: VIDEO
Subject: AUTO, PICTURE/BRIGHT
1. Feed the signal. Using the set's control
switch or the remote controller button, select
the subject AUTO. The setting will adjust
itself.
2. Then adjust the PICTURE/BRIGHT setting
until the signal becomes bit-less.
